What is the Family Court Affidavit Form?

The Family Court Affidavit Form serves a crucial role in legal proceedings within family courts, acting as a formal document where parties provide sworn statements. This affidavit is often utilized during various steps in family court cases, providing necessary testimonies that can support claims made by individuals.
Sworn statements are vital to ensuring the integrity of legal filings, serving as reliable evidence in disputes. Additionally, this form is fillable and requires signatures from the appropriate parties, reinforcing its legal validity.

Signing and Notarizing the Family Court Affidavit Form

The signing and notarizing process of the Family Court Affidavit Form involves critical legal requirements. There is a distinction between digital signing and traditional wet signatures, which may affect the acceptance of the document.
Notarization is often necessary, and only authorized individuals can perform this task. Essential documentation is required for validation, ensuring the affidavit holds legal weight in court proceedings.
